High-Stakes Competition and StrategyBuilt on gamesmanship, physical endurance, and social politics, these programs eliminate contestants week by week. "Survivor," "Big Brother," and "The Challenge" require intense strategic planning, forming alliances, and backstabbing, turning human interaction into a literal sport.

By the late 2000s, the focus shifted from survival competitions to the dramatic lives of the wealthy. The launch of Keeping Up with the Kardashians (2007) and The Real Housewives franchise turned everyday personal drama into a highly lucrative entertainment commodity. 2. The "fly-on-the-wall" format solidified in 1992 with MTV’s The Real World , which brought diverse strangers together to live in a house.
